Definition of fresh force
Definition: Fresh force refers to a newly committed act of force, such as disseisin or deforcement. It is a term used in legal contexts to describe force used in a town, for which a remedy exists, known as the Assize of Fresh Force.
Example: If someone forcefully takes possession of a property in a town, that act of force is considered fresh force. The Assize of Fresh Force allows the rightful owner to seek a remedy for this act of force.

Simple Definition
Term: Fresh Force
Definition: Fresh force refers to the use of force in a town that is newly done and illegal, such as taking someone's property without permission. There is a legal remedy called the Assize of Fresh Force to address this issue.
